What is Ivermectin 1 mg/ml Oral Suspension (Vet)?

Ivermectin 1 mg/ml Oral Suspension (Vet) is a liquid dosage form of the medication Ivermectin, specifically designed for veterinary use. It involves one or more ingredients uniformly dispersed throughout a liquid medium, providing a homogeneous mixture for administration.

How is the Ivermectin 1 mg/ml Oral Suspension (Vet) administered?

This medication is administered orally. The uniform dispersion of the ingredients in the liquid medium ensures that the animal receives a consistent dose of the medication with each administration.

What does the '1 mg/ml' in Ivermectin 1 mg/ml Oral Suspension (Vet) mean?

'1 mg/ml' refers to the concentration of the active ingredient, Ivermectin, in the suspension. This means that there is 1 milligram of Ivermectin in every milliliter of the suspension.

What is the purpose of the liquid medium in the Ivermectin 1 mg/ml Oral Suspension (Vet)?

The liquid medium serves as a vehicle for the active ingredient, Ivermectin. It allows for the uniform dispersion of the medication, ensuring that each dose administered contains the correct amount of the active ingredient.

Is the Ivermectin 1 mg/ml Oral Suspension (Vet) a homogeneous mixture?

Yes, the Ivermectin 1 mg/ml Oral Suspension (Vet) is a homogeneous mixture. This means that the active ingredient is uniformly dispersed throughout the liquid medium, ensuring a consistent dose with each administration.
